My drilling results also improve a lot when I keep my bits sharp. A dull bit can slip, overheat, and make rough holes, but a properly sharpened bit cuts cleaner and more accurately. I notice better performance in my projects, especially when I need consistency and precision.

Sharpness and Accuracy
For me, the main purpose of any drill bit sharpener is to restore clean, precise cutting edges. I wanted a tool that could sharpen bits evenly so they would drill properly again. Accuracy matters because poorly sharpened bits can slip, overheat, or damage materials.
